Introduction

Pakistan is endowed with abundant mineral resources, and feldspar is one of the most significant industrial minerals found in the country, particularly in regions like Khyber Pakhtunkhwa, Gilgit-Baltistan, and Balochistan. With the rapid growth of Pakistan’s ceramics and porcelain industry, the demand for high-quality feldspar powder has surged. Feldspar serves as a vital fluxing agent in porcelain production, lowering the melting temperature and enhancing the strength, translucency, and aesthetic appeal of ceramic bodies. To meet the stringent quality requirements of the porcelain sector, efficient and reliable grinding equipment is essential. Importance of Feldspar Grinding for Porcelain

Porcelain production relies heavily on finely ground feldspar, which must meet specific particle size distribution and purity standards. Typically, porcelain manufacturers require feldspar powder with a fineness of 200 to 325 mesh (74–44 microns) or even finer for premium products. The grinding process not only reduces particle size but also increases the specific surface area, ensuring uniform mixing with other raw materials such as kaolin, quartz, and ball clay. Properly ground feldspar improves the vitrification process, reduces porosity, and imparts a smooth glossy finish to final products. In Pakistan, where traditional grinding methods using ball mills are still common, the industry faces challenges such as high energy consumption, inconsistent product quality, and low production capacity. Modern grinding mills with advanced technology can address these issues, enabling local manufacturers to compete in international markets.

Challenges in Pakistan’s Porcelain Industry

Despite the abundance of feldspar reserves, Pakistan’s porcelain industry has been hindered by several factors:

  • Inconsistent Quality: Many local grinding operations rely on outdated equipment that cannot achieve uniform particle size distribution, leading to defects in porcelain tiles and tableware.
  • High Energy Costs: Conventional ball mills consume excessive electricity, increasing production costs in a country where energy prices are volatile.
  • Environmental Concerns: Dust emissions and noise pollution from open-air grinding operations violate environmental regulations in urban areas.
  • Limited Capacity: Existing grinding lines often have throughputs below 5 tons per hour, insufficient to meet the growing demand from new ceramic factories being established across Punjab and Sindh.

To overcome these hurdles, Pakistani porcelain manufacturers are increasingly turning to advanced grinding solutions that offer higher efficiency, better product consistency, and lower operating costs.
